I see UT is going to hire a shadow staff that handles football operations on the non-coaching side so that the coaches coach and these guys handle recruiting, game prep/game plans and are basically a staff of GAs/aids/assistants that do the dirty work so that the coaches just focus on coaching. There will also be a max of like 5 that handle football conditioning and nutrition. The football program will be broken into three components of coaching, recruiting/scouting/GP and conditioning/nutrition. All together this makes the football staff out to about 20-25 total.
 
Evidently this is a Tom Herman deal. I caught a snippet of him talking about support staff referencing Alabama. Saban has non-coaching support on the payroll that includes x-head coaches. I don't know what their functions are but it's probably the wave of the future since Nick is doing it. Maybe Urban had something similar when Herman was with him at OSU.
